simplified lemonade cake
Although I love the recipe I got from a relative for a "from scratch" lemonade cake, I don't always have the time or patience. This is just as yummy, very lemony and takes much less effort to put out. Perfect for lemon lovers!

Ingredients
- CAKE
- 1 3oz packages lemon flavored jello
- 3/4 cup boiling water
- 1 box lemon cake mix
- 3/4 cup applesauce (plain)
- 4 - eggs
- FROSTING
- 2 tablespoons softened butter or margarine
- 2 teaspoons grated lemon zest
- 2 teaspoons thawed lemonade concentrate
- 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 8 ounces cream cheese (i use the 1/3 less fat)
- 3 1/2 cups powdered sugar
How To Make simplified lemonade cake
-
Step 1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Grease and flour a 10 inch bunt/tube pan.
-
Step 2Cake: Dissolve the lemon jello in boiling water and put aside. DO NOT allow to set. Combine cake mix, vegetable oil and eggs. Beat until combined and add the liquid jello. Beat for 5 minutes on medium speed setting. Pour batter into a prepared bunt pan and bake at 350 degrees for 1 hour. Cool completely before removing from pan.
-
Step 3Frosting: In a large bowl, beat butter, lemon, lemonade concentrate, vanilla and cream cheese on high speed until fluffy. Add powdered sugar and beat at low speed until blended. Chill 1 hour before icing cake.
-
Step 4Sometimes instead of using the icing on the cake I dust it with powdered sugar instead.
